25 |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Nolan Tcheng conducted an unannounced random annual inspection. Upon arrival 12pm, LPA met with Site Supervisor Lisa Seggelke. At 12:10pm, LPA on a tour of the facility. This is a preschool program which consists of 3 classrooms. Per licensee, there are currently 38 enrolled in the program. There is also an Infant License on site (#198017610). Hours of operation for this facility are 7am-5pm, Monday-Friday.
Licensing staff observed all required forms/publications to be posted in the office. Snack menus were reviewed to ensure that they are being posted one week in advance where it is visible by the child's authorized representative. Menus for the past 30 days are available upon request.
PHYSICAL PLANT: At 12:10pm, LPA entered and inspected Room 1 (3-5s): 9 children with 2 staff members, Room 2 (2-5s): 7 children with 2 staff members, Room 3 (2-5): 12 children with 1 staff member (Nap Time). At 12:15pm, LPA observed the napping area of the facility. Napping equipment was observed to be cots. Disinfectants, cleaning solutions, medication and other items that are dangerous to children, were inaccessible to children. Furniture and equipment are in good condition, free of sharp, loose, or pointed parts. All floors are clean and safe. All storage containers for solid waste, including moveable bins shall have tight-fitting covers that are kept on, and in good repair. Trash cans used to discard food have tight fitting lids. The facility was observed to be free of flies, other insects and rodents. Sufficient individual storage space for children was observed and each child has a cubby. Drinking water was readily available indoors. At this time, the office is used as an isolation area. A cot is available for an ill child to rest on. First Aid supplies are available and complete. Facility has a functioning carbon monoxide detector that meets statutory requirements. Director states there are no weapons, firearms, or bodies of water on the premises. At 12:35pm, fire extinguisher was observed. The valve on the required 2A 10BC fire extinguisher indicates fully charged and was serviced on 05/02/2023, as indicated on service tag. Per State Fire Marshall standards, fire extinguishers shall be serviced annually.
